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Awareness of daily tasks, targets, and responsibilities.
- Coiling of bulk hose and assemblies for transfer and packing.
- Preparation of assemblies for shipping (painting and protection).
- Packing of components for shipping (couplings and rubber).
- Create advice notes for collections.
- Communicate with haulage companies for transport collections
- Communicate with the production/planning team in the transfer of goods around site.
- Training in the use of the coiling machine
- Operating forklift trucks in compliance with HSE (loading goods for shipment).
- Ensuring all forklift checks are carried out and up to date.
